soundhack wrote:how did you end up micing the drums?
very simple, to be honest.
we used one mic for the bassdrum, one for snare + hihat, one for crashs and toms and one overhead. we didn't want to place too much mics because they would bleed anyway and we didn't want the frequencies to cut each other .. or how it is called.
best sound came from the DI of the bass-amp and the musicmaster bass which we used sounds awesome.
